Публикации по теме 'foreach'


Методы JavaScript — 10 лучших
Массивы JavaScript — это мощный инструмент для организации данных. Храните несколько значений в одной переменной для удобного управления и обработки больших объемов информации. Благодаря встроенным методам, таким как поиск, сортировка и управление, JavaScript упрощает работу с массивами. В этой статье мы покажем 10 лучших методов массива, которые необходимо знать, с полезными примерами, которые помогут вам начать работу. .forEach() Метод forEach используется для выполнения..

JavaScript: использование forEach() для перебора массива
У каждого программиста есть любимый цикл — будь то фруктовый цикл, цикл forEach() или цикл for! Давайте сегодня углубимся в циклы forEach(). Представляем метод forEach(): Метод forEach() позволяет вызывать функцию один раз для каждого элемента массива. Этот метод: не имеет встроенного возвращаемого значения — возвращает undefined ничего не сохраняет в памяти работает только с синхронными функциями Синтаксис и вызовы методов: Функция forEach имеет три параметра —..

Получение индексов с помощью foreach в C#
Привет, сегодня я здесь с чрезвычайно простой статьей. При написании foreach иногда может потребоваться доступ к индексу, хотя использование блоков for в таких случаях имеет больше смысла, можно получить доступ к индексу при использовании foreach. Обычно я бы не стал писать на эту тему, но она немного обсуждалась на stackoverflow. Для этого необходимо иметь некоторое представление об использовании списков. Если нам нужно объяснить на простом примере, допустим, вы печатаете..

Возврат наибольших чисел в массивах
Возвращает массив, состоящий из наибольшего числа из каждого предоставленного подмассива. Для простоты предоставленный массив будет содержать ровно 4 подмассива. [Вариант 1] Настройка: создайте переменную, чтобы вернуть ее, чтобы сосредоточиться на нашем конечном результате, который представляет собой отсортированный массив. Помните, что вы можете перебирать массив с помощью простого цикла for и обращаться к каждому члену с помощью синтаксиса массива arr[i] ...

Вопросы по теме 'foreach'

Является ли лучшей практикой кодирования определение переменных вне foreach, даже если это более подробно?
В следующих примерах: first кажется более подробным, но менее расточительным по ресурсам второй менее подробный, но более расточительный по ресурсам (переопределяет строку в каждом цикле) Какая практика кодирования лучше? Первый...
3506 просмотров
schedule 08.01.2024

Динамическое группирование узлов XSLT посредством трансформации
Я пытаюсь создать подобную страницу с помощью XSLT-преобразования. Страницы Страница 1 страница 2 Ссылки ссылка1 ссылка2 Вот xml <siteMenu> <Pages> <title>page1</title> </Pages>...
276 просмотров
schedule 11.11.2022

Перебор массива через второй массив
Ищете цикл по массиву URL-адресов и вводите каждое ключевое слово из второго массива в каждый URL-адрес, но не можете разобраться с пониманием массивов. Например: $key = array("Keyword+1", "Keyword+2", "Keyword+3"), $url...
128 просмотров
schedule 13.11.2022

Странная ошибка компиляции структуры Foreach в С#
namespace MyNamespace { public struct MyStruct { public string MyString; public int MyInt; public bool MyBool; } public class MyClass { private List<MyStruct> MyPrivateVariable;...
1601 просмотров

Перезапустить цикл foreach в С#?
Как я могу перезапустить цикл foreach в С#?? Например: Action a; foreach(Constrain c in Constrains) { if(!c.Allows(a)) { a.Change(); restart; } } restart здесь похоже на continue или break , но он перезапускает...
18389 просмотров
schedule 04.03.2024

Обновление MYSQL, заменить удаление массивом PHP
У меня есть запрос, который мне нужно запустить в массиве $_POST с php, это довольно просто, так как он принимает все значения в массиве, а затем запускает запрос для каждого из значений, которые обновляют базу данных, вот сложная часть: как массив...
1129 просмотров
schedule 06.04.2024

не удалось найти функцию внутри цикла foreach
Я пытаюсь использовать foreach для многоядерных вычислений в R. A <-function(....) { foreach(i=1:10) %dopar% { B() } } затем я вызываю функцию A в консоли. Проблема в том, что я вызываю функцию Posdef внутри B , которая...
16053 просмотров

Смешивание для каждого и лямбда-выражений в С++
Я хотел немного поиграть с лямбда-выражениями и для каждого (цикл for на основе диапазона, а не STL for_each) в C++0x. Итак, я пошел в вики и попытался переписать примеры из вики, используя лямбда-выражения: std::vector<int> some_list;...
203 просмотров
schedule 02.02.2024

Оператор PHP foreach по ссылке: неожиданное поведение при повторном использовании итератора
этот код выдает неожиданный результат: $array=str_split("abcde"); foreach($array as &$item) echo $item; echo "\n"; foreach($array as $item) echo $item; выход: abcde abcdd если использовать &$item для второго цикла,...
2336 просмотров
schedule 21.09.2022

Проблемы с вложенным запросом цикла foreach из нескольких таблиц в mysql
Я только начинаю php и mysql. У меня есть два запроса из моей базы данных. Сначала выполняется запрос к таблице под названием lifestyles, затем выполняется цикл foreach и выводится каждый элемент в своей строке. Теперь в каждой из этих строк есть...
1917 просмотров
schedule 14.10.2023

Ввод php foreach в строку с одной переменной, разделенную запятыми
Привет, это, вероятно, действительно просто, но я не могу этого сделать для жизни. у меня есть значения вывода foreach. $tags = get_the_tags(); foreach($tags as $v) { echo $v; } это выведет php,css,cms,seo мне нужно...
12212 просмотров
schedule 24.11.2023

while vs foreach при чтении из STDIN
Возможный дубликат: В чем разница между перебором файла с помощью foreach или в то время как в Perl? В цикле while Perl считывает строку ввода, помещает ее в переменную и выполняет тело цикла. Затем он возвращается, чтобы найти...
7722 просмотров
schedule 24.03.2024

для каждого цикла увеличение более чем на один в php
у меня есть один класс в php, возвращающий количество записей. я использую таблицу для отображения такого имени foreach($getArtist as $getArtist) { echo "<tr><td>".$getArtist['name']."</td></tr>"; } это отлично...
374 просмотров
schedule 08.11.2023

Проблема Knockout IE8 с привязкой данных foreach и привязкой данных входного значения
Я использую Knockoutjs 2.0. Я пытался заставить эту таблицу работать в IE8 (она отлично работает в FF, Chrome и IE9): <table data-bind="foreach: Applications"> <tr> <td><input type="text" data-bind="value:...
4590 просмотров

Вручную увеличить перечислитель внутри цикла foreach
У меня есть вложенный цикл while внутри цикла foreach, где я хотел бы бесконечно продвигать перечислитель, пока выполняется определенное условие. Для этого я пытаюсь привести перечислитель к IEnumerator‹ T > (что должно быть, если он находится в...
10009 просмотров
schedule 18.12.2023

Разный вывод для каждого другого оператора Foreach?
В настоящее время я использую следующий код, чтобы получить подкатегории на странице категории и получить сообщения для каждой подкатегории. В той части, где он повторяет «span-12» (строка 14), я хочу, чтобы он отображал «span-12 last» для каждой...
383 просмотров

Отображение 5 элементов массива на строку в таблице HTML
У меня есть массив продуктов, и мне нужно отображать их по 5 элементов в строке. Как я могу это сделать, потому что теперь, если я это сделаю <?php foreach($data as $entries) : ?> <td><?php echo $entries->name; ?> <?php...
4577 просмотров
schedule 05.08.2022

Изменение значения внутри цикла foreach не меняет значение в повторяемом массиве
Почему это дает это: foreach( $store as $key => $value){ $value = $value.".txt.gz"; } unset($value); print_r ($store); Array ( [1] => 101Phones - Product Catalog TXT [2] => 1-800-FLORALS - Product Catalog 1 ) Я пытаюсь получить...
22206 просмотров
schedule 04.04.2024

Базовый взрыв foreach
У меня есть следующий код, из которого я хочу отображать элементы массива, разделенные запятыми. Код выводит список disered, но без запятых. Что мне не хватает? <?php $array = get_field('casts'); $elements = $array;...
2604 просмотров
schedule 02.03.2024

получить все значения в таблице Sql, используя foreach
Мне нужно получить все идентификаторы из таблицы «StaffSectionInCharge», в ней есть только два столбца StaffId и SectionId, у меня есть значения StaffId и StudentId ..... проблема в том, что я не могу получить записи непосредственно в эту таблицу...
205 просмотров
schedule 12.05.2024